Two tornados hit Champaign County

Nov 18, 2013

There were dozens of reported tornados Sunday across the state, including two in Champaign County that hit at almost the same time. Illinois Public Radio’s Sean Powers arrived in Gifford Sunday just as the skies were clearing, and the cleanup was beginning.